need shorefishing tips
#1
Hello, I'm heading tfo hiltonhead tomorrow and plan to do some shore fishing while I'm there. I'm use to fishing in the lakes of Utah and Idaho and havent done a whole lot of ocean fishing. Does anyone have any advice for catching anything of the larger size fish from the shore. Any help would be greatly appreciated.

surf you need a long rod to get past the breakers on a pire it really don't matter. 10 to 20lb test would be good line. Mud minow or srimp good bait. Bait cast reels work good for me unless I use a light lure.I sometimes use a Storm 3in pearl white swim bait for flounder in the creeks. Might work good for you since your into lake fishing. I was down just last weekend got 8 flounder , only 3 keepers and some whiting. People were jiging up some nice spanish mackerel on the pire useing gold hooks , not sure of the size of hook. 12 to 13ft rods. I got sun burn and didn't feel up to it. I am red..good luck
